A leading technology company is seeking a Chief Engineer for their London data center. In this role, you will ensure operational efficiency of electrical, mechanical, and fire/life safety equipment. Key responsibilities include supporting engineering teams, overseeing maintenance, and managing projects from conception to completion. Candidates must have a NVQ Level 3 or equivalent in Electrical/Mechanical Engineering, and experience with UPS and mechanical infrastructure is preferred. Chief Engineer, you will be responsible for ensuring that all electrical, mechanical, and fire/life safety equipment within the data center is operating at peak efficiency. This involves planned preventative maintenance, daily corrective work, and emergency response. You are expected to be a singular focal point for all facility operations and to support Amazon within its owned and operated data centers.
You should be able to manage large-scale, high-impact projects and new region support from conception to completion. These projects involve substantial independent work as well as collaboration with external support groups including engineering, automation, procurement, and finance in local and global settings. As Chief Engineer, you will create and deliver on key milestones, obtain and track quotes for costs, and document project results for future implementation at other facilities. The goals are to drive innovation and resiliency while reducing operational costs in the facilities.
